Output 77d49b415dac786e6d2aa324d346f4e77b3bb820d284fffb2801155109bd15b0:0

value
2149422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3dc138caeec5955c45bb1e7da08e7541afac41 OP_EQUAL
address
3EkQXmkR7A517ze9sHGDptcQ5KtcgXE56D
transaction
77d49b415dac786e6d2aa324d346f4e77b3bb820d284fffb2801155109bd15b0
confirmations
46487
spent
true